Technology Selection Rationale and Advantages

This section explains the reasoning behind the technology choices made for DocuSnap-Frontend and the advantages these technologies bring to the application.

Jetpack Compose

Rationale: Traditional XML layout systems are complex and difficult to maintain, especially for complex UI interactions.

Advantages: - Declarative UI simplifies building complex interfaces - Built-in animation and state management - Seamless integration with Kotlin, improving development efficiency - Reduced boilerplate code, improving readability - Real-time preview, accelerating development iteration

MVVM Architecture

Rationale: Need for clear separation of UI, business logic, and data access.

Advantages: - Separation of concerns, improving code maintainability - Support for unit testing, improving code quality - Clear UI state management, reducing state-related bugs - Well-suited for data-driven application scenarios - Compatible with the Jetpack component ecosystem

Kotlin Coroutines

Rationale: Asynchronous operations (such as network requests, database access) need a concise handling approach.

Advantages: - Simplifies asynchronous programming, avoiding callback hell - Structured concurrency, making lifecycle management easier - Combined with Flow, supports reactive programming - Reduces the complexity of thread management - Improves code readability and maintainability

Room Database

Rationale: Need for reliable local data storage and offline functionality support.

Advantages: - Type-safe data access - Compile-time SQL validation - Seamless integration with Kotlin Coroutines and Flow - Simplified database migration - Support for complex queries and relationship mapping

CameraX

Rationale: Need for stable, consistent camera experience while simplifying camera operations.

Advantages: - Simplifies camera lifecycle management - Cross-device consistency - Built-in common use cases (preview, photo capture, video recording) - Integration with Jetpack lifecycle components - Support for image analysis and extension features
